From Dürer to Cassatt: Five Centuries of Master Prints from the Jones CollectionMay 20, 2006 through September 17, 2006U.S. Bank Gallery, Galleries 315, 316, and 344
This exhibition showcases the remarkable depth of the Herschel V. Jones Collection, the seminal gift at the core of the print holdings of The Minneapolis Institute of Arts...
